A 5.4” would be pretty close to the 6/7/8 (not the SE); almost the same width, and 0.22” (1/5”) less tall.

SE (4.0) 2.31 x 4.87
8 (4.7”) 2.65 x 5.45
XS (5.8”) 2.79 x 5.65
XR (6.1” ) 2.98 x 5.94
Max (6.5”) 3.05 x 6.20

With the same bezel width as the XS, the 5.4” would be:

11S (5.42”) 2.58 x 5.23

However, although the physical size of the 5.4” would be close to the 6/7/8, it would be much more difficult to use one-handed, since the 11S will require a 5.4” diagonal thumb stretch—almost the same (5.5”) as a 6/7/8 Plus—instead of the 4.0” stretch of the SE or even the 4.7” of the regular 6/7/8.

Anyone who likes the SE because it’s operable one-handed will be very disappointed with a 5.4” 11S.

No, it’s very logical. More expensive parts = more expensive selling price.

For instance, the current XS has more expensive parts than the larger XR: a more expensive screen (the XS’s OLED is more expensive than XR’s LCD, even though it’s smaller); more RAM (4GB vs. 3GB); a better rear camera; a stainless steel vs. aluminum frame; a faster cellular modem; 3D Touch; and probably some other things I’ve forgotten.
